Comprehensive Overview Of Innovations In Modern High-Efficiency Solid-State Lighting Systems Across The Global LED Lighting Market industry
The global LED Lighting industry is undergoing a monumental transformation driven by an urgent worldwide push toward energy conservation, decarbonization, and smart building integration. Traditional incandescent and fluorescent lighting fixtures are being rapidly phased out as commercial enterprises, municipal governments, and residential homeowners adopt high-efficiency light-emitting diodes (LEDs). These advanced semiconductor-based luminaires offer exceptional luminous efficacy, converting a significantly higher percentage of electrical energy directly into visible light while generating minimal waste heat. By utilizing robust semiconductor materials and sophisticated driver electronics, modern LED systems deliver prolonged operational lifespans that often exceed tens of thousands of hours, drastically reducing the frequency of maintenance replacements and lowering long-term operational expenditures for facility managers.
Beyond basic illumination, the industry is witnessing an integration of digital connectivity and intelligent control mechanisms that elevate standard fixtures into smart network endpoints. Architectural designers and corporate facility planners now leverage Internet of Things (IoT) protocols, wireless sensors, and automated dimming software to dynamically adjust illumination levels based on ambient natural sunlight, occupancy density, and specific task requirements. This level of granular control not only optimizes building energy efficiency but also supports human-centric lighting designs aimed at improving occupant well-being, circadian rhythms, and productivity levels in office environments. Consequently, smart connected luminaires have evolved from simple utility hardware into core components of modern intelligent architecture and sustainable smart city infrastructure frameworks.
The manufacturing ecosystem supporting this sector is characterized by continuous research and development focused on improving thermal management, color rendering indices (CRI), and luminous output consistency. Leading component producers are deploying advanced materials such as ceramic substrates and specialized phosphors to ensure color stability over extended usage periods while mitigating thermal degradation risks. Furthermore, the proliferation of automated surface-mount technology (SMT) assembly lines has streamlined production volumes, driving down component costs and making premium-grade commercial lighting solutions accessible to a broader cross-section of global consumer and industrial markets. These manufacturing efficiencies continue to attract heavy capital investments from technology conglomerates seeking to capture market share in high-growth regions.
Looking forward, the ongoing convergence of artificial intelligence, edge computing, and solid-state lighting points toward an era of fully autonomous lighting ecosystems. As standards bodies harmonize protocols for wireless device interoperability, lighting systems will increasingly interact with HVAC systems, security networks, and emergency response platforms. This holistic integration ensures that the sector will maintain its robust upward trajectory, solidifying its role as a fundamental pillar of global green technology adoption and sustainable urban development.
